The Barber Institute of Fine Arts has been described as ‘one of the finest small galleries in Europe’. Opened in 1939 by Queen Mary this outstanding collection of paintings and sculptures is housed in a Grade ll listed building bequeathed to the University by Lady Barber in memory of her husband. The architecture of the galleries is outstanding and the paintings to be enjoyed in the Institute include masterpieces by Rubens, Van Dyck, Poussin, Gainsborough, Turner, Monet, Degas, Renoir and Van Gogh. |
